A. Kuchar is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Computer Networks and Communications and Signal Processing. According to data from OpenAlex, A. Kuchar has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 357 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 6 papers in Computer Networks and Communications and 4 papers in Signal Processing. Recurrent topics in A. Kuchar's work include Wireless Communication Networks Research (5 papers), Millimeter-Wave Propagation and Modeling (4 papers) and Direction-of-Arrival Estimation Techniques (4 papers). A. Kuchar is often cited by papers focused on Wireless Communication Networks Research (5 papers), Millimeter-Wave Propagation and Modeling (4 papers) and Direction-of-Arrival Estimation Techniques (4 papers). A. Kuchar collaborates with scholars based in Austria, Germany and United Kingdom. A. Kuchar's co-authors include E. Bonek, Jean‐Pierre Rossi, Andreas F. Molisch, Klaus Hugl, J. Laurila, J. Fuhl, Reiner S. Thomä, Martin Haardt, Cornelis Hoek and Juha Laurila and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Transactions on Antennas and Propagation, IEEE Transactions on Vehicular Technology and Wireless Personal Communications.
